Pounds to Grams Conversion

Professor Greenline Explaining Math Concepts

We can measure the weight of things using units like grams, kilograms, pounds, or ounces. Different units are used to measure different things. A gram is a small unit of measurement that we use for lighter objects, like a paperclip or a coin. A pound (lb) is a larger unit of measurement, and we use it to measure heavier things, like a bag of flour or a person's weight. Sometimes we need to change pounds to grams to make it easier to understand weights. In this topic, we will learn how to convert pounds to grams.

What is a Pound?

A pound is a unit of weight that is part of the imperial system, which is commonly used in countries like the United States.

 

One pound is equal to 16 ounces.

 

The symbol for pounds is lb. Pounds are commonly used to measure heavier objects or body weight.

Professor Greenline from BrightChamps

What is a Gram?

A gram is a unit of weight that is part of the metric system, which is widely used around the world for measuring small weights.

 

The metric system is based on powers of 10, which simplifies unit conversions.

 

1 gram is equal to one-thousandth of a kilogram, meaning there are 1,000 grams in 1 kilogram (1,000 g = 1 kg). The symbol for grams is g.

Pounds to Grams Formula

To convert pounds to grams, we use the following formula: 1 pound = 453.592 grams Grams = So, to convert from pounds to grams, you multiply the number of pounds by 453.592.

 

Conversely, to convert from grams to pounds, you divide the number of grams by 453.592.

Professor Greenline from BrightChamps

How to Convert Pounds to Grams?

Converting pounds (lb) to grams (g) is simple using a standard conversion factor.

 

Since 1 pound is equal to 453.592 grams, we can convert pounds to grams by multiplying the number of pounds by 453.592.

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them in Pounds to Grams Conversion

When converting pounds to grams, people often make mistakes. Here are some common mistakes to get a better understanding of the concepts of conversions.

Mistake 1

Red Cross Icon Indicating Mistakes to Avoid in This Math Topic

Using the wrong conversion factor

Green Checkmark Icon Indicating Correct Solutions in This Math Topic

People get confused and use incorrect values for conversion, such as 450 instead of 453.592.

Mistake 2

Red Cross Icon Indicating Mistakes to Avoid in This Math Topic

Rounding too soon

Green Checkmark Icon Indicating Correct Solutions in This Math Topic

People might round numbers too early while calculating, which can lead to incorrect results.

 

For example, instead of writing 5 × 453.592 = 2267.96, they might round it to 2300, which is not accurate.

Mistake 3

Red Cross Icon Indicating Mistakes to Avoid in This Math Topic

Misplacing decimal points

Green Checkmark Icon Indicating Correct Solutions in This Math Topic

People get confused and place the decimal point incorrectly, which leads to improper values.

 

For example, instead of writing the value for 10 pounds as 4535.92 grams, they write it as 453.592 grams.

Mistake 4

Red Cross Icon Indicating Mistakes to Avoid in This Math Topic

Incorrect use of formula

Green Checkmark Icon Indicating Correct Solutions in This Math Topic

People get confused and use the incorrect formula.

 

For example, instead of multiplying, they divide. To convert any value from pounds to grams, we multiply pounds by 453.592, not divide.

Mistake 5

Red Cross Icon Indicating Mistakes to Avoid in This Math Topic

Misunderstanding the relationship between pounds and ounces

Green Checkmark Icon Indicating Correct Solutions in This Math Topic

People often get confused about pounds and ounces. They might think 0.5 pounds equals 5 ounces, but it actually equals 8 ounces.

 

Remember, 1 pound is equal to 16 ounces, so half a pound (0.5 pounds) is 8 ounces.

Important Glossaries for Pounds to Grams

  • Conversion: The process of changing one unit of measurement into another. For example, converting pounds to grams.

 

  • Decimal: A number system based on powers of ten, using a point to separate the whole number from the fractional part. For example, 3.5 where 3 is the whole number, and 5 is the fraction.

 

  • Weight: The measure of how heavy something is, often measured in pounds or grams.

 

  • Metric System: A system of measurement based on powers of ten, commonly used worldwide, including units like grams and kilograms.

 

  • Imperial System: A system of measurement primarily used in the United States, including units like pounds and ounces.
